So I made some time today, and I've got most of a rewritten BatchNavigator that will let us use indexable DB constraints rather than large OFFSET values to navigate batches. This has come up in previous performance centric mails on this list, and Jeroen had a really clear description of the semantic problems we have with batching that he presented during the Epic - this work should go a fair way towards addressing both of those things (at the cost of some fuzziness around what 'page 3' actually means).
The core grungy is roughly done, I have 'merely' integration glue - to make sure that the existing URL's wont break and that the generation of URLs adjacent to the current batch is done cheaply (e.g. without materialising the adjacent batches). I'll skip the details for now, as its not done and is subject to change without notice, but the code is at lp:~lifeless/lazr.batchnavigator/keyoffset if you're interested in playing around.
